Given : A body is projected up with a velocity 50 m/s.
After one sec acceleration due to gravity disappears
To Find : Body behavior
Solution
A body is projected up with a velocity 50 m/s
After 1 sec velocity of body
using V = U + at
U = 50 m/s
a = -g = - 10 m/s²
t = 1 sec
V = 50 - 10(1)
=> V = 40 m/s
40 m/s velocity after 1 sec
acceleration due to gravity disappears
so Body will keep moving upward with a velocity of 40 m/s
